Unified Threat Management: A Holistic Security Approach

Fortunately, modern technology offers robust solutions to enhance data protection. One such approach is Unified Threat Management (UTM), a comprehensive security framework that integrates multiple protective measures into a single system. UTM leverages appliance-based tools to deliver holistic security coverage, ensuring that organizations remain protected against a wide array of cyber threats. By combining real-time monitoring, systematic updates, and intelligent data gathering, Unified Threat Management (UTM) provides organizations with an effective defense mechanism against cyber incursions.

Proactive Measures Against Security Threats

To avert security threats and vulnerabilities, organizations must adopt a proactive approach. This begins with minimizing susceptibility to cyber risks by identifying and addressing potential weaknesses within their systems. Implementing strict access controls, encrypting sensitive data, and continuously assessing network traffic for anomalies are essential steps in fortifying security defenses. Additionally, organizations should limit the use of high-risk applications and technologies that cybercriminals often exploit, such as proxies, tunneling methods, and unsecured encryption.

Mitigating Evasive Cyber Threats 

Cybercriminals employ advanced techniques to evade detection, often concealing threats within encrypted traffic or utilizing non-standard ports to bypass security protocols. Organizations must deploy sophisticated solutions for cybersecurity capable of identifying and neutralizing such threats. An integrated threat detection engine can analyze network traffic in real-time, perform intrusion prevention, and block unauthorized file transfers. This comprehensive security approach ensures that organizations maintain visibility over all data exchanges, effectively mitigating risks and preventing unauthorized access.
